SENIOR ACCOUNTANT

Memorial Health · Springfield, IL · 2 wk ago
Finance$29.44/hrFull-time

Overview

Under the general direction of the Accounting Manager, serves Memorial Health System management or one of its affiliates management by providing lead financial analyst support for the general ledger application. Assures that established departmental deadlines are met as well as provide assistance and support to attain departmental goals and objectives.

Responsibilities

  • Assists Manager in development and measurement of departmental goals and objectives.
  • Helps determine departmental priorities and implements plans on schedule.
  • Affords a lead role in coordinating information flow and completion of monthly financial statements in accordance with GAAP and RHS policies and procedures, within the time frames established to meet the monthly financial statement deadlines.
  • Assists in analyzing and reconciling all general ledger accounts and related schedules in accordance with GAAP and MHS policies and procedures.
  • Completes IRS and other statutory reports and filings for assigned corporations in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Completes workpapers as required for the year end audit by the public accounting firm.
  • Promotes guest relations and open communications as well as support the System’s Statement of Values by setting an example and treating everyone fairly and with courtesy and respect.
  • Maintains confidentiality of sensitive employee data and patient clinical and financial information.
  • Ensures departmental compliance with the Code of Conduct and corporate compliance plan.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or Degree in accounting or finance required. MBA and/or CPA preferred but not required.
  • Minimum of three years experience in accounting or finance required, preferably in the healthcare setting.
  • Experience with personal computers and software (including Excel, Word, Power Point and Outlook).
  • Must be able to work in a fast changing environment.
  • Possess good analytical skills and good human relation skills.
  • Show initiative to inquire, review, follow up, investigate, to take the lead on projects, etc.
  • Strong understanding of GAAP, accrual accounting, tax issues, etc.
  • Strong analytical skills and a high level of accuracy.
  • Candidate should be able to recognize inaccurate numbers and have the ability to independently resolve errors and determine resolutions.
  • Strong understanding of journal entries along with P/L or B/S effects of entries.
  • Must possess ability to compile data, analyze and develop recommendations along with clear presentation of analysis.
  • Strong communication and presentation skills required.
